### Audit Item 7.3 — Proctor Queue Plugin Hooks

External plugins integrating with the Vigilhall exam-proctoring queue must verify that the pre-assignment hook cannot reorder candidates already in REVIEW state. Confirm your plugin honors the queue's fairness token, backs off on HTTP 429 responses, and never persists candidate session payloads beyond the hook lifetime. Record test evidence against the Ashpole sandbox before submitting. Exceptions to any of these requirements must be approved in writing by the person named below.

named custodian: Brivan Eliath Quenox Frador

## ProctorQueue Environments

Welcome to the team! ProctorQueue runs in three environments: sandbox (break things freely), staging (mirrors exam-day load), and prod (don't touch on Mondays — peak exam windows). Each env has its own broker and retry policy, so a stuck queue in sandbox tells you nothing about prod. Staging is the one you'll use most, and it currently runs with these values.

config for kafof-bawef:
holath:
  log_level: debug
  metrics_host: metrics.holath.qorvelsys.internal
  pin: 2191
  pool_size: 32

Subject: Key rotation heads-up for Pulsewire telemetry

Hi plugin folks,

Quick one: we're rotating the keys for the Pulsewire telemetry intake this Friday. While we're at it, payloads are now gzip-compressed by default, which should shave your upload times nicely — the SDK handles it automatically if you're on 3.2 or later. Old keys stop working Monday, so swap yours out before then. No other config changes needed.

For internal plugin builds, the new service key is as follows.

app token of yajeg-kawef = kto11_7En3XSX8xQw

Cold starts on the Pellworth ingest handlers are still blowing the SLO after the runtime bump. Provisioned concurrency masks it but doubles cost; prefer trimming the dependency graph and lazy-loading the Quillbase client. I've pinned init memory and warmup intervals per tier so rollout is predictable. Don't ship without these. The constants we settled on are listed here.

tuning table, yajog-yahof:
BUDGETS = {
    "lamvan": 303,
    "wenox": 460,
    "fenvan": 525,
}